Understanding Zexel and Bosch Diesel Pumps
Zexel, originally known as Diesel Kiki, was founded in 1939 in Japan under a Bosch license. The company specialized in manufacturing diesel fuel injection pumps and related components. In 2000, Bosch acquired Zexel, integrating its technologies and expertise into the Bosch Group. Today, Zexel pumps are recognized for their reliability and precision in diesel fuel delivery systems.
Bosch, a global leader in automotive technologies, produces a range of diesel fuel injection pumps, including the VE and PFR series. These pumps are widely used in various applications, from automotive engines to industrial machinery, due to their durability and efficiency.
Common Issues Leading to Rebuilds
Several factors can lead to the need for rebuilding a Zexel or Bosch diesel supply pump:
  • Wear and Tear: Continuous operation can cause internal components to wear, affecting performance.
  • Contaminated Fuel: Impurities in the fuel can damage the pump's internal components.
  • Improper Maintenance: Lack of regular maintenance can lead to premature failure.
  • Aging Components: Over time, seals and gaskets can degrade, leading to leaks and loss of pressure.
Rebuilding Process
Rebuilding a diesel supply pump involves several meticulous steps to ensure it meets factory specifications:
  1. Disassembly: Carefully dismantling the pump to inspect all internal components.
  2. Cleaning: Thoroughly cleaning all parts to remove contaminants and debris.
  3. Inspection: Checking each component for wear or damage and replacing as necessary.
  4. Reassembly: Rebuilding the pump with new seals, gaskets, and other components.
  5. Calibration: Adjusting the pump to factory settings to ensure optimal performance.
  6. Testing: Running the rebuilt pump on a test bench to verify functionality.
